"Compassion is the ability to feel another’s pain. To understand their thoughts and the impact of actions on another’s life. It is a rare thing today and often frowned upon. I sometimes feel most of humanity is in suffering their own personal pain which leaves one with little room to feel for another. Yet it is only by understanding we all suffer in the same way can we gain any understanding of our personal pain.
These paintings were, for me, an emersion into the pain of another. The process of painting them was intense and required a deep scrutiny. I entered into the world of deep anguish and as invalid as it seemed for a brief moment I took on their pain and believed that perhaps by doing so I may elevate it.
Within the work I focused on children caught in the crossfire of a political situation. I tried to highlight the fragility of the human juxtaposed against a cold metal presence. Whilst at the same time shadowing this presence to represent the faceless aspect of this
power." |
